My good friend, P. A. is in Greenville for the evening, so we met up for some showing off of cards and good old-fashioned baseball talk. P. A. had a huge box of stuff he brought for me that I took delivery of that will help in a lot of facets of my collection. There were a bunch of cards that he gave me but there was one card in particular that he was really excited about sending my way.
This 2008 Topps Stadium Club card of Jimmie Foxx is really awesome because it contains a piece of bunting from the old Yankee Stadium. I remember when 2008 Stadium Club came out, P. A. was a huge fan of it right away and came into the old Winston-Salem card shop that I was "working" at and bought a box. He busted the box with me at one of the tables and pulled this card. I remember both of us being really excited that he pulled it, not knowing at the time that I would begin a PC of Foxx a few years later.
This card is really amazing. I was so surprised that P. A. was willing to part with this card, and even more surprised that he gifted it to me. Thank you so much for the card, P. A. I appreciate it so much.

Mail From Anthony - Earl Weaver SIgned Ticket
Back in August of 2010, I purchased a Juan Marichal ball from Anthony. You might remember him. He used to run the blog called 'Mike Pelfrey Collectibles.' Sadly, that blog is no more. I believe he blogs about women's soccer now. Anyway, Anthony and I have chatted off and on since our initial transaction. I sent him some Donruss Elite Extra Edition women's soccer cards recently in exchange for a couple bucks and some Orioles cards. After that, I found three more cards he might like and sent them on to him.
In exchange, he sent me this signed ticket to the 2008 All Star Fan Fest! The ticket is signed by former Orioles' manager and Hall of Famer, Earl Weaver. This is a pretty lopsided trade in my favor. Mainly because Anthony is an awesome dude.
He messaged me on Facebook saying that he had the ticket signed in person at the Fan Fest, the day before the 2008 All Star game. The ticket was modeled to look like it was from a Yankee Stadium game. I think it is really awesome. I'm going to put it in a safe place. Thanks again for the trade Anthony. If I find more women's soccer cards, they're definitely on the house because I don't feel that I gave you enough for this ticket!
